PROMOTION ON THE BASIS OF EXCEPTION. An employee who does not satisfy the degree requirements or educational requirements for promotion may apply on the basis of exceptional Teaching/ Primary Duties or exceptional Scholarly/Professional Activities. Department Criteria will specify exceptional performance in each of the two areas. In addi- tion to exceptional performance in the employee’s chosen area, the employee will be expected to meet or exceed regular promotion requirements in each of the two other areas of responsibility.
PROMOTION ON THE BASIS OF EXCEPTION. An Employee who does not satisfy the eligibility requirements for promotion to Professor in Section 19.6 may apply for promotion on the basis of exception based on exceptional teaching/performance of primary duties and research/creative activities, and superior service.
